일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| 7 |
8 | 9 | 10 | 11 | 12 | 13 | 14 |
15 | 16 | 17 | 18 | 19 | 20 | 21 |
22 | 23 | 24 | 25 | 26 | 27 | 28 |
29 | 30 | 31 |
- linux
- java
- codeigniter
- css
- JavaScript
- html
- SQL
- 제이쿼리
- 오라클
- Eclipse
- 공모주 청약 일정
- 7월 공모주 청약 일정
- Stock ipo
- 6월 공모주 청약 일정
- 주식 청약 일정
- 주식
- MYSQL
- 리눅스
- jquery
- 코드이그나이터
- 자바스크립트
- php
- 맥
- 주식 청약
- IPO
- 공모주
- 공모주 청약
- Stock
- 자바
- Oracle
- Today
- Total
목록개발/php (530)
개발자의 끄적끄적
[php] php memory_limit / php 메모리 설정 방법 php 를 사용하다보면 메모리 부족 현상이 나타나는 경우가 있습니다. 그럴때는 아래의 두가지 방법으로 해결할 수 있습니다. 1. php 설정을 변경하는 방법 우선 리눅스 커맨드창을 열어서 아래 명령어로 php 설정파일을 엽니다. vi /etc/php.ini 파일이 vi 편집기를 통해서 열리고 나면 아래와 같이 메모리 제한이 되어있는 부분이 있습니다. memory_limit = 128M 위 내용에서 128 이라고 되어있는 부분의 수치를 조정하면 메모리를 조정할 수 있습니다. 변경후 wq 로 파일을 저장 후 apache 와 php-fpm 서비스를 재시작 해줍니다. 2. 페이지 상단에 임시로 메모리를 높게 설정하는 방법 메모리 부족 현상이 ..
[php] php array_file example / php 배열 채우기 함수 array_fill 사용법 및 예제 php 에서 배열을 다루다보면 여러가시 상황들이 생깁니다! 그중에서 api 통신이나 몇몇 상황들이 배열의 갯수를 맞춰야 하는 경우가 있습니다. 즉, 데이터가 1개만 존재해도 강제로 특정 갯수만큼 빈데이터를 채워야 하는경우 php 내장함수인 array_fill 을 사용하시면 됩니다. 아래는 기본 사용법입니다. array_fill("시작인덱스","채울개수","채울내용"); array_fill("START INDEX","COUNT","VALUE"); 위 사용법대로 배열의 5번 인덱스부터 3개를 채우는데 데이터는 test 로 채운 배열을 $arr 라는 변수에 저장합니다. $arr = array_f..
[php] php preg_replace example / php preg_replace 공백제거 정규식 php 에서 정규식을 이용해야 하는경우 아래와 같은 preg_replace 를 사용합니다. preg_replace 제가 공유하고자 하는 내용은 위에 나온 preg_replace 를 활용하여 문자열에 포함되어 있는 공백을 전체 제거하는 정규식입니다! 우선 아래와 같은 문자열이 있다고 가정하고, $str = "Hello World"; 아래와 같은 정규식을 이용하여 preg_replace 로 공백을 제거하고 $replace_str 라는 변수에 담아줍니다. $replace_str = preg_replace("/\s+/", " ", $str); 그리고 아래처럼 echo 를 이용해서 $replace_str 을 ..
[php] array_flip example / php에서 배열의 키과 값을 교체하는 방법 php 에서 배열을 다루다보면 배열의 키와 값을 서로 변경해야하는 경우가 있습니다! 그럴때는 php 내장함수인 array_flip 를 이용하시면 됩니다! 아래는 기본 사용법입니다. array_flip(array_name) 아래와 같이 [0] => aaa [1] => bbb 라는 값을 가지는 $arr 라는 배열이 있다고 가정하고. $arr = array('aaa','bbb'); array_flip 를 이용하여 새로 만들어진 배열을 $new_arr 라는 변수에 저장하고 print_r 을 이용하여 $new_arr 를 출력하면, $new_arr = array_flip($arr); print_r($new_arr); 결과는 ..
[php] php array_search example / php에서 배열에 특정 값이 있는지 확인하는 방법 php 에서 배열을 다루다보면 특정 데이터나 텍스트가 있는지 확인을 해야하는 경우가 있습니다. 그럴때는 php 내장함수인 array_search 를 이용하면 됩니다! 아래는 기본 사용법입니다. array_search("search_value", array_name); 위 사용법을 가지고 아래와 같이 aaa, bbb, ccc, ddd 라는 4개의 값을가지는 $arr 라는 배열이 있다고 가정하고, $arr = array('aaa','bbb','ccc','ddd'); array_search 함수를 이용하여 bbb 라는 값이 있는지 확인한 결과를 $result 라는 변수에 담습니다. $result = a..
[php] php array_sum example / php에서 배열안의 숫자 합을 구하는 방법 php 에서 배열을 다루다보면 특정 숫자만 들어있는 배열 안의 값들을 다 더해야는 경우가 있습니다. 즉, 배열안의 숫자들의 전체 합을 구해야 하는경우 php 내장함수인 array_sum 을 이용하시면 됩니다! 아래는 기본 사용법입니다. array_sum(array_name) 위 사용법대로 아래와 같이 1~5 까지의 정수가 들어있는 $arr 라는 배열이 있다고 가정하고, $arr = array(1,2,3,4,5); 아래처럼 array_sum 을 이용하여 $arr 배열의 합을 출력해보면 echo array_sum($arr); 결과는 이렇게 15가 나옵니다. 15 참고들 하세요!
[php] 날짜를 timestamp 로 만드는 mktime() 사용법 및 예제 php 에서 date 형식의 날짜를 timestamp 로 변환하고자 할때 strtotime 을 사용합니다. 하지만 시분초년월일의 정보만 가지고도 날짜형식을 맞추지 않고 php 내장함수인 mktime 로도 timestamp 값을 얻을 수 있습니다. 아래는 기본 사용법입니다. mktime(시, 분, 초, 월, 일, 년도); 아래는 예제입니다. echo mktime('00', '00', '00', '1', '1', '2021'); // result : 1609426800 위 내용을 보시면 아시겠지만, 2021년 1월 1일 0시 0분 0초의 timestamp 값을 mktime 함수로 출력하는 내용입니다. 위내 나와있듯이 출력한 결과는..
[php] 맥 phpstorm 자동 줄바꿈 설정 방법 맥 OS 에서 php 개발툴들이 여러가지 있는데 phpstorm 을 사용합니다! 여러가지 기능들 중에서 자동줄바꿈 기능을 설정하는 방법을 공유하고자 합니다! 위 이미지 처럼 상단 맨윗줄 메뉴바중에서 view -> Active Editor 메뉴로 가면 위와 같은 서브 메뉴가 나옵니다. 그중에 이미지처럼 Soft-Wrap 라고 되어있는 항목을 클릭하면 자동 줄바꿈 처리가 됩니다! 참고들 하세요!